¡El último evento de Pokémon Sleep presenta al legendario Pokémon de tipo Agua, Suicune! Hasta el 16 de septiembre, el evento Suicune Research te permite investigar los patrones de sueño únicos de Suicune.

Cómo obtener recompensas Suicune en Pokémon Sleep

Atrapar a Suicune no se trata de captura directa. La clave es recolectar muestras de Suicune Mane. Acumula lo suficiente y podrás cambiarlos por Incienso Suicune y Galletas Suicune, vitales para estudiar los hábitos de sueño de Suicune.

Consigue la ayuda de otros Pokémon de tipo Agua para aumentar tu colección de muestras. Explora Greengrass Isle, luego Cyan Beach y finalmente Lapis Lakeside para maximizar tus posibilidades.

Los Pokémon de tipo Agua útiles durante este evento incluyen Squirtle, Wartortle, Golduck, Blastoise, Psyduck, Slowpoke, Vaporeon, Totodile, Slowbro, Feraligatr, Wooper, Croconaw, Slowking, Quaxly, Quaxwell y Quagsire. Estos Pokémon aparecerán independientemente de tu tipo de sueño.

Ubicaciones clave

Centra tus esfuerzos en Greengrass Isle, Cyan Beach y Lapis Lakeside. Incluso podrías ver al Snorlax local disfrutando de su nuevo refrigerio favorito: ¡Oran Berries!
